To solve this problem, we need to identify the reagents that convert an alkene to an aldehyde.The transformation involves converting cyclohexyl ethene to cyclohexyl propanal.Step 1: Hydroboration-Oxidation• The first step is hydroboration using BH• This adds across the double bond in an anti-Markovnikov manner, forming an alcohol.• The second step is oxidation using HOOH which converts the borane intermediate to an alcohol.Step 2: Oxidation to Aldehyde• The alcohol is then oxidized to an aldehyde using PCC (Pyridinium chlorochromate).Therefore, the correct sequence of reagents is:(i) BH (ii) HOOH (iii) PCC.This corresponds to Option 4.
